Lower KS2 Class Teacher – Full-Time – September Start – Wednesbury

Smile Education is working with a welcoming primary school in Wednesbury to find a Lower KS2 Class Teacher for a long-term, full-time role starting in September.
This is a fantastic opportunity open to both experienced teachers and Early Career Teachers (ECTs) looking to develop their skills in a supportive environment.

Role Details:
  • Lower KS2 Class Teacher (Year 3 or Year 4)
  • Location: Wednesbury, West Midlands
  • Full-time, long-term position starting September
  • Supportive leadership and collaborative staff team
  • Well-resourced classrooms and engaging curriculum
About You:
  • Qualified Teacher Status (QTS)
  • Strong understanding of the Key Stage 2 curriculum evidence by references
  • Passion for teaching and making a positive impact
  • Enhanced DBS or willingness to obtain one
